Ras Girtas Power Company (also known as Ras Laffan C power and desalination plant) is a power generation and water desalination plant located in Ras Laffan Industrial City, Qatar. [1] [2] It has installed capacity of 2,730 MW, which include eight gas turbines and four steam turbines by Mitsubishi Heavy Industries. [3]
Ras Abu Fontas B power station was commissioned in the 1990s. [7] Daily capacity is currently 609 MW. After an expansion was announced, Ras Abu Fontas B1 power station was officially opened in July 2001, costing nearly QR 780 million. This added 377 MW to the plant's capacity.
